How do you prepare the press conference for the day of the opening?

A press conference on the opening day deserves separate preparation. Schedule the press moments 30 to 45 minutes before the official opening. That gives journalists time to capture footage and quotes. Work with a press kit: press release, fact sheet, high-resolution photos and contact details for the spokesperson. Send the invitation 2 weeks in advance with a clear RSVP. A deadline of 3 days before the opening helps with planning the room layout. Appoint 1 spokesperson on behalf of the company. Give the board and speaker a short media training: core message in 30 seconds, 3 quotes ready, handling tricky questions. Count on 20 to 40 minutes for the press conference itself: a short presentation, press rounds and one-to-one conversations. Plan a separate room with good sound and lighting for cameras.
